Robotic Slime for Medical Retrieval
Robotic slime is a cutting-edge technology that holds promise for medical retrieval procedures. This innovation combines the principles of soft robotics and magnetism to create a device that can navigate through the human body with remarkable precision.
Context / Why this matters
Swallowing foreign objects is a common occurrence, particularly among children and the elderly. These objects can sometimes become lodged in the digestive tract, necessitating medical intervention. Traditional methods for removing these objects often involve invasive procedures, such as endoscopy or surgery, which can be risky and uncomfortable for patients.
The development of robotic slime offers a less invasive alternative. By utilizing magnetic fields to control its movement, this technology can potentially retrieve swallowed objects without the need for surgery. This not only reduces patient discomfort but also minimizes the risks associated with invasive procedures.

The Science Behind Robotic Slime
Developed by researchers at The Chinese University of Hong Kong, robotic slime is a novel application of soft robotics. Unlike traditional robots, which are typically rigid and rely on motors and electronics, robotic slime is composed of a soft, magnetic material. This material allows it to take on different forms and navigate through the body with ease. Let's break down the key features of this technology.
Magnetic Control
The movement of the robotic slime is controlled by external magnetic fields. These fields can be precisely manipulated to guide the slime through the body. This precision allows doctors to navigate the slime through the digestive tract, even through narrow passages as small as 1.5 mm. The ability to control the slime's movements with such accuracy is a significant advantage, as it enables doctors to retrieve objects from hard-to-reach places.
Adaptability
One of the standout features of robotic slime is its adaptability. The slime can change its consistency to fit the situation. For instance, it can become more rigid when needed or flow through tiny gaps. This adaptability is crucial for navigating the complex and often unpredictable environment of the human body.
Self-Healing and Electrical Conductivity
In addition to its magnetic and adaptable properties, robotic slime can self-heal after being cut. This feature ensures that the slime remains functional and effective, even if it encounters obstacles or damage within the body. Furthermore, the slime can conduct electricity, which opens up the possibility of using it to repair broken circuits or other electrical components within the body.
Potential Medical Applications
The potential applications of robotic slime in medical retrieval are vast. Beyond retrieving swallowed objects, this technology has the potential to revolutionize other medical procedures as well.
Minimally Invasive Surgery
The ability of robotic slime to flow through narrow passages and change its consistency makes it an ideal candidate for minimally invasive surgeries. This technology could be used to repair or retrieve objects in areas of the body that are difficult to access with traditional surgical methods. For example, robotic slime could navigate through twisted or obstructed vessels to retrieve foreign objects or repair damage.
Targeted Drug Delivery
Another potential application of robotic slime is in targeted drug delivery. By encapsulating medications within the slime, doctors could deliver drugs directly to specific sites within the body. This targeted approach could improve the effectiveness of treatments while reducing side effects, as the medication would be concentrated in the affected area rather than distributed throughout the body.
Diagnostic Procedures
Robotic slime could also be used in diagnostic procedures. Its ability to navigate through the body makes it an excellent tool for imaging and sampling. For example, robotic slime could be used to take tissue samples from hard-to-reach areas or to provide detailed images of the internal environment.
